The Mercedes-Benz G-Wagon (aka G-Class) is a 4x4 "terrain vehicle", originally developed as a military off-roader in Austria. The car is characterised by its boxy good looking styling and body-on-frame construction; it uses three fully locking differentials which makes it rather unique, yet highly capable.

The G-Class is one of the companies longest-produced vehicles with a span of 42 years. This example is the first generation of the G-Class known as W460 ('79-'92), there were three engine options and five body variants with this particular example packing the most powerful 3.0L OM 617 inline-5 diesel.

Exterior

Highly sought after with its timeless boxy good looks and rugged build.

Wheels and Tyres

The car is fitted with 15" 5-spoke alloys, which all look in great condition with just some minor age-related marks in places. The tyres all around are Yokohama Geolandar I/T dated 2005/06 and look to have a good amount of tread.

A full-size spare wheel and tyre can also be found on the rear of the car.

Bodywork

If you're reading this far down then you'll be just like us, i.e you're big fans of the square and boxy good looks this G-Wagon offers.

All the bodywork looks in great shape on this particular example, with all the panel gaps and shut lines looking tight and true. We did notice some very minor stone chips to the front bumper and patches of bubbling on the front bumper bar - nothing major.

Mechanics

The creme-de-la-creme - 3.0L inline-5 diesel block offers the driver mighty power and 3 fully locking differentials.

Engine and Gearbox

Packing a punch with the most powerful engine option of the time, a 3.0L OM 617 inline-5 diesel offers the driver 111bhp to tap into and accent any incline.

Micheal reports both the engine and gearbox are smooth in operation.

Suspension and Brakes

This classic off-roader has bags of appeal thanks to its timeless design and rugged build. Originally engineered and built by Steyr-Daimler Puch in Austria it was designed for military use and therefore came with excellent off-road abilities.

Michael reports the suspension and brakes work well with not issues to note.
